Student of the Month Luncheon to Highlight School Choice


Five students from area schools will be honored at the Soldotna Chamber of Commerce Student of the Month Luncheon in celebration of National School Choice Week.

The luncheon will take place at noon Tuesday, Jan. 24 at Soldotna Regional Sports Complex and is planned to coincide with the history-making celebration of National School Choice Week 2017, which will feature more than 21,000 school choice events across all 50 states.

The guest speaker will be Bridgit Gillis, program director for the Amundsen Education Center. Student Ambassadors for the chamber will give National School Choice Week yellow scarves to attendees.

"It is an honor for the Soldotna Chamber of Commerce to give back to our community through our youth development programs. Each month, the Soldotna Chamber recognizes five local students, from both the private and public sectors, for excellence in the classroom and in their community," said Sara Hondel, tourismand education coordinator for the Soldotna Chamber. "Soldotna's educational opportunities are very diverse: we have one homeschool program, one Montessori school, one performance based school, 3 public elementary schools, one middle school, one prep school, one high school, and three private schools. We are excited to highlight them all to commemorate School Choice Week!"
